We’ve got new storytellers in the house! Kavitha and Debjani, co- founders of Once Upon A Time -tells a tale, are here for a very-berry Indian time!

 Do you know what we celebrate on January 26? What does a Republic mean? Come on over to Hippocampus, as we celebrate Republic Day, talk about the Great Indian rivers and indulge in some craft!

Debjani and Kavita are the co-founders of Once Upon a Time- tells a tale. They will be presenting a story telling session on ‘India’. They will begin with a brief narration on the major physical features of India through gestures. Then the focus will be on the Himalayas, River Ganga and her formation from a mythological and geographical perspective. This also includes an art and craft activity based on the narration.

We celebrate Republic Day every year, but do you know about our kings and queens, who ruled our lands for gazillions of years? Do you know from where India gets her name?

 Well, Aunty Asha is here from the World Storytelling Institute to tell us more about our country! Sing along, play a game and celebrate India with us.

Asha Sampath is a popular storyteller from the World Storytelling Institute. She will cover India in her entirety, beginning with her name, touching upon her as a land of kings and queens, showing her extent, tell childhood anecdotes from the lives of 4  eminent persons, one from each direction, culminating with a mention of the father of the nation, leading on to her freedom and bringing into focus the present….Incredible India!
